Haute Event Preview: The National Committee on American Foreign Policy Gala Awards Dinner

On Thursday, March 8, 2012, The National Committee on American Foreign Policy will host its annual 2012 Gala Awards Dinner at The Mandarin Oriental Hotel in New York. This elegant and significant affair will honor Former U.S. Ambassador to Afghanistan, The Honorable Karl W. Eikenberry and Chairman of the Board and CEO of The Coca-Cola Company, Muhtar Kent. Scott Pelley, managing editor of the CBS Evening News and correspondent for 60 Minutes, will be leading the event as Master of Ceremonies. The event underscores the important workthat the National Committee does year-round to help advance American foreign policy interests through Track I 12 and Track II diplomacy.
Proceeds from the evening will benefit the National Committees educational programs that address security challenges facing the United States.
